The biomass balance approach

Reduce CO2 emissions and save fossil raw materials in the production of styrenic foams

With the REDcert-certified biomass balance (BMB) approach, fossil resources needed to produce the styrenic foams can be replaced 100% by renewable raw materials. This production method saves valuable resources while reducing the CO2 impact. The biomass-balanced products Styropor® BMB, Neopor® BMB and Styrodur® BMB protect the environment and climate without sacrificing the usual quality: This is because they are unchanged from their fossil counterparts in terms of formulation and properties.

Neopor® BMB

The use of renewable raw materials reduces the carbon footprint of Neopor® BMB by 90% compared to traditionally produced Neopor®.

The central CO2 saving of Neopor® results during its many years of use as insulation boards on the facade, reducing the energy required to heat or cool buildings and thus simultaneously reducing greenhouse gas emissions.

BASF's biomass balance products

The approach is applied to many BASF products, such as superabsorbents, dispersions, plastics and intermediates. The resulting biomass balanced products offer BASF customers a differentiation opportunity such as a quantifiably improved CO2 footprint and savings of fossil resources. Customers can rely on the identical product quality and performance to which they are accustomed to and benefit from a sustainable drop-in solution, making a conscious contribution to environmental protection.
